On Thanksgiving 1968, Kathie Sarachild presented " A Program for Feminist Consciousness Raising ," at the First National Women's Liberation Conference near Chicago, Illinois, in which she explained the principles behind consciousness-raising and outlined a program for the process that the New York groups had developed over the past year.
